    This guy's on a whole other level, citing misleading pseudoscience to claim human races are entirely different species, akin to wolves and coyotes. Meanwhile a random black person will often be more genetically similar to a random white person than another black person.

    There's more genetic variation between 2 communities of chimpanzees separated by a river than all genetic variation in 8 billion humans. Zero basis for us being different sub-species, let alone species. Humans might have diverse phenotypes, but we're extremely genetically alike compared to other species.
